Demographics: 55 years old, Female
Indication: Shoulder pain

Findings

Diagnosis

Greater tuberosity fracture

Sample Report

Acute minimally displaced fracture of the greater tuberosity.

No joint malalignment.

Mild degenerative changes of the acromioclavicular joint.

Glenohumeral joint space is maintained.

Right cervical carotid artery calcification.
